Understanding Psychiatry and the Role of Psychiatrists
Psychiatrists are qualified medical physicians who concentrate on mental health. They are certified to identify and treat a vast array of mental health conditions, from stress and anxiety and anxiety to schizophrenia and bipolar illness. Their training allows them to combine their understanding of both the physical and mental elements of wellness.

Private psychiatry describes mental health services provided outside of a public or government-funded health care system. In this context, clients can engage with psychiatrists privately, frequently through direct payment for services instead of counting on openly financed programs.
Features of Private PsychiatryDirect Access: Patients can frequently secure appointments more rapidly than through public systems.Personalized Care: Private psychiatrists might provide more individualized and versatile treatment alternatives.Privacy: Privacy and confidentiality may be enhanced in private settings.Advantages of Seeing a Psychiatrist Privately
A number of benefits included going with private psychiatric care, including:
Reduced Waiting Times: One of the greatest advantages of private services is that individuals typically experience much shorter wait times to see a psychiatrist.Personalized Treatment Plans: Private practitioners might offer customized treatment techniques that line up with a person's requirements and situations.Greater accessibility of professionals: Patients can access a vast array of professionals who might have niche proficiency.Versatile Scheduling: Private psychiatrists regularly provide consultations beyond conventional workplace hours, making it much easier for people to fit them into busy schedules.Enhanced Comfort: Many people find a private psychiatrist private settings more comfy and less challenging than public centers or healthcare facilities.Disadvantages of Seeing a Psychiatrist Privately
While private psychiatry private has its benefits, it also includes downsides. Key drawbacks to think about include:
Cost: Private psychiatric care can be expensive and may not be covered by insurance coverage.Lack of Collaboration: There may be less chances for cooperation with other health care suppliers within a public system.Quality Variability: The quality of care might differ considerably between professionals, as there is less regulation in private psychiatrists near me sectors.Potentially Less Comprehensive: Private practices may provide minimal services compared to multidisciplinary teams readily available in public settings.How to Find a Private Psychiatrist
Discovering a suitable private psychiatrist includes several steps. Here is a list of considerations:
Research Credentials: Ensure that the psychiatrist is certified and holds the necessary licenses.Examine Specializations: Look for psychiatrists who specialize in the specific concerns you are facing.Referrals and Reviews: Ask for recommendations from main care physicians or examine online evaluations from previous patients.Insurance Compatibility: Verify whether the psychiatrist accepts your insurance (if appropriate).Preliminary Consultations: Many psychiatrists use a preliminary assessment.
